Question

Write balanced chemical equations for the following reactions:

Zinc+SilvernitrateZincnitrate+Silver

Solution

Balanced chemical equation: A balanced chemical equation is the representation of a chemical reaction in which the number of atoms of each element is the same on both the reactant and product sides.

Word equation to symbolic equation:

  • In the given reaction, zinc reacts with silver nitrate to form Zinc nitrate and silver.
  • The chemical reaction can be represented as:

Zn(s)Zinc+AgNO3(aq)SilvernitrateZn(NO3)2(aq)Zincnitrate+Ag(s)Silver

Balancing the Chemical Equation:

Step 1: Write the number of atoms of each element

Zn(s)Zinc+AgNO3(aq)SilvernitrateZn(NO3)2(aq)Zincnitrate+Ag(s)Silver

ElementReactant sideProduct Side
Zn11
O36
Ag11
N12
  • From the table, it is clear that the Atoms of Nitrogen and Oxygen are not balanced.

Step 2: Balancing the unbalanced atoms

  • In order to balance the equation, we will make the coefficient of AgNO3 and Ag as 2.
  • Now the equation becomes

Zn(s)Zinc+2AgNO3(aq)SilvernitrateZn(NO3)2(aq)Zincnitrate+2Ag(s)Silver

ElementReactant sideProduct Side
Zn11
O66
Ag22
N22

Hence, the balanced chemical equation is Zn(s)Zinc+2AgNO3(aq)SilvernitrateZn(NO3)2(aq)Zincnitrate+2Ag(s)Silver
